E-file Submission Report is blank and does not display any taxpayer information
🔍 What This Guide Covers
This guide explains what to do when your E-file Submission Report is blank and does not display any taxpayer information.
It is most likely caused by an issue with SAP® Crystal Reports® Basic Runtime for Microsoft® Visual Studio® 2008, which installs when you install TaxWise.
⚠️ Before You Begin
Note: If TaxWise is on a network, perform the following steps on each workstation that is affected.
📊 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Close TaxWise
Use this when you need to make sure the program is not running before repairing the runtime.
- Close TaxWise (on the affected workstation if on a network).
Step 2: Open Control Panel
Use this to access the uninstall/repair options for the Crystal Reports runtime.
- Click the Microsoft® Windows® Start button, and click Control Panel.
- If in Category view, click Uninstall a program under Programs. If in Large Icons or Small Icons view, click Programs and Features.
Step 3: Repair Crystal Reports Basic Runtime
Use this to repair the component that is most likely causing the blank report.
- Locate Crystal Reports Basic Runtime for Visual Studio 2008
- Left-click to highlight.
- Click Repair at the top of the program list.
Step 4: Watch for the repair result
Use this to confirm whether the repair completed successfully or if you received a network-related installer error.
You will see one of the following:
- A small box displays as it is repairing and the box will automatically close when finished with no message
- A Microsoft® Windows® Installer box with a message, "The feature you are trying to use is on a network resource that is unavailable."
Step 5: Re-create and send the e-file
Use this to verify whether the repair fixed the blank E-file Submission Report.
If Crystal Reports® Basic Runtime for Microsoft® Visual Studio® 2008 runs the repair with no errors, re-create the e-file and attempt to send.
- If the repair fixed the issue, your E-file Submission Report will now be populated.
- If the repair did not correct your issue or you receive the Microsoft® Windows® Installer error mentioned above, you will need to contact Technical Support for assistance.
